An electrical engineering intern is typically a student who is working towards or has just completed a degree in electrical engineering. In this job, your responsibilities vary depending on your employer and your area of specialty, but you can expect to perform basic duties as an assistant. An electrical engineering internship is a chance to learn about a specific area in the broad field of electricity. In your internship, you may partner with an experienced engineer who guides you as you try to put your classroom knowledge of electrical repair and design to use in the real world.
| Aspect | Electrical Engineering Intern | Electrical Technician |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ically pursuing or have completed a bachelor's degree in electrical engineering | Vocational training or associate degree in electrical technology |
| Work Environment | Design labs, project planning, research, and development settings | Fieldwork, install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ting in industrial or commercial sites |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Engineering firms, tech companies, construction projects | Manufacturing plants, utility companies, maintenance services |
The main difference between an Electrical Engineering Intern and an Electrical Technician lies in their focus and experience. Interns are primarily involved in learning, assisting with design and research tasks, and gaining industry knowledge. Technicians, on the other hand, perform hands-on install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ting work. Internships are often a stepping stone toward a career in electrical engineering, while technicians are more focused on practical, technical skills required for day-to-day operations.

This is an UNPAID internship through the DoD SkillBridge Program for transitioning active-duty US military personnel. DoD SkillBridge Internships are available to help transitioning active-duty military personnel gain real-world experience in the work force sometime during their final 180 days of active-duty service. The intern will actively train on meaningful projects and work closely with a mentor and with senior company leadership. HII Mission Technologies Internship programs are focused on placing transitioning military into internships that require KSAs, Education & Military Training similar to their current or previous military jobs; positions that could easily transition over to a full-time regular and permanent job with HII.Â
Objective
The SkillBridge intern will train as an Inside Machinist (Marine Mechanic) within HII-Mission Technologies, reporting to a designated HII Supervisor, with the goal of learning the performing as an Inside Machinist at HII Mission Technologies SEMAT Hawaii, capable of independently machining, fabricating, and refurbishing shipboard components while providing technical support to USN Surface Ships at Pearl Harbor. The intern will be assigned special projects as needed.
Â
Desired End State (3-4 month target)
At the end of four months, the intern will gain a deeper understanding:
Machine Shop Operations Proficiency
Technical Documentation & Quality Control
Shipboard Component Fabrication & Customer Interface
Assumptions/Restrictions
Training Location:Â Pearl Harbor, HI
Weeks 1-2: Orientation & Safety Foundation
Focus: Facility familiarization, safety protocols, basic tool proficiency
Weeks 3-4: Lathe Operations & Precision Measurement
Focus: Conventional lathe setup and fundamental turning operations
Weeks 5-6: Milling & Advanced Machining
Focus: Milling machine operations and multi-axis work
Weeks 7-8: Technical Documentation & Blueprint Reading
Focus: Navy technical standards and documentation systems
Weeks 9-10: Shipboard Component Fabrication
Focus: Real-world component refurbishment and repair
Weeks 11-12: Customer Interface & Program Completion
Focus: Professional skills and independent operations
Continuous Throughout:Â Weekly progress reviews, physical conditioning for shipboard work (30+ lb lifting), professional development
